Hammerheads Add Rodriguez To Squad
UNC-Charlotte standout led 49ers to NCAA Championship game

Wilmington Hammerheads News Release -- www.wilmingtonhammerheads.com

Tuesday, July 10, 2012

WILMINGTON, N.C. – University of North Carolina-Charlotte captain Charles Rodriguez has signed with the Wilmington Hammerheads as the club aims to bolster its defense. Selected by D.C. United in the 2012 MLS Supplemental Draft, Rodriguez will join the Hammerheads for the remainder of the season.

As the star of Charlotte’s defense, Rodriguez led the 49ers to the school’s first National Championship game last fall in his senior season. Also named a First Team All-American, Rodriguez started in all but one of UNC-Charlotte’s games over his entire collegiate career. His stellar play allowed the team to record nine shutouts in 2011, which led many to consider UNC-Charlotte one of the best defensive units in college soccer.

Growing up in Franklin, Tenn., Rodriguez has always been the captain of the backfield he plays on. He has received many honors at all levels, but his most notable performance and favorite memory was anchoring the defense during UNC-Charlotte’s unexpected run to the 2011 NCAA Championship game. Rodriguez aspires to have the same impact on another North Carolina team, the Wilmington Hammerheads, about 206 miles east from his collegiate program.
